Define the Situation
Assault rates against U.S. healthcare workers have climbed 23 percent in recent years, according to the International Association for Healthcare Security and Safety. Meanwhile, a study in the Journal of Patient Safety found that every minute of delay in critical-care response increases mortality risk by up to 10 percent. Most hospitals still rely on a patchwork of legacy tools—overhead paging here, handheld radios there, and a separate nurse-call system on the wall.
“The physician I’m working with told me an outside 911 call would reach them faster than their internal Code Blue,” says Tessa McAuley, Clinical Solutions Specialist. “They were waiting eight or nine minutes. That’s too late.”
Benefits and Risks
Integrated platforms knit those disparate tools together, compressing steps that once depended on human relay. “We design with open architecture so duress buttons, RTLS badges, and security alarms all talk to each other,” notes Gina Brody, Market & Product Development Manager.
Benefits
- Speed: Automated alerts shave minutes off response.
- Clarity: Multichannel notifications—blinking corridor lights, mobile push alerts, recorded overhead pages—reach every clinician, regardless of location.
- Accountability: Digital breadcrumbs track who responded, when, and with what equipment.
Risks
- Trust Gap: “If clinicians lose faith, they’ll shove the device in a drawer,” McAuley warns. Robust training and user-centric design are mandatory.
- Alert Fatigue: Too many pings erode attention. Systems must filter notifications to the right role at the right time.
Future Prospects or Impacts
Real-time location services (RTLS) will anchor the next wave. Badges already cancel calls automatically when a nurse enters the room and escalate if backup is needed. “I picture a hallway display that tells you which patient needs what before you even cross the threshold,” Brody says.
Analytics turn every incident into a dataset for process improvement. Hospitals mine timestamped logs to compare actual versus target arrival times, pinpoint bottlenecks, and justify staffing adjustments. Facilities piloting these reviews report double-digit cuts in adverse events, according to an Agency for Healthcare Research and Quality briefing.
Takeaways and Lessons
– Map current workflows before adding tech; integration should overlay, not overhaul, existing infrastructure.
– Standardize activation steps—“flip the cover, push the button, start compressions”—so muscle memory replaces guesswork.
– Pair rollout with live drills; debrief using incident analytics to reinforce trust and refine protocols.
– Revisit configurations annually as units, staff levels, and clinical priorities evolve.
